Whenever used in this chapter, unless a different meaning clearly appears from the context, the words set out in this section shall have the following meanings:

A. “Hotel” means any public or private hotel, inn, hostelry, bed and breakfast, house, motel, roominghouse or other lodging place within the city offering lodging, wherein the owner and operator thereof, for compensation, furnishes lodging to any transient as defined in subsection B of this section.

B. “Transient” means any person who, for any period of not more than thirty consecutive days, either at his or her own expense or at the expense of another, obtains lodging or the use of any lodging space in any hotel as defined in subsection A. of this section, for which lodging or use of lodging space a charge is made.

C. “Person” means any individual. For the purpose of this section and the transient lodging tax, Bakersfield Municipal Code Sections 3.40.010 and 3.40.020 only, “person“ does not mean partnership, corporation or association of any nature whatsoever. (Ord. 4579 § 1, 2009; Ord. 3829 § 1, 1998)
